Colorado Code § 30-1-116

Officers shall collect fees in advance

(1) Except as provided in section 30-
1-106, every officer shall collect every fee, as prescribed, for services performed by him or her
in advance, if the same can be ascertained, and when any officer negligently or willfully fails to
collect any such fee, the same shall be charged against his or her salary.
(2) In proceedings where a public administrator, special administrator, receiver, or other
person is appointed by the court to take possession of assets of an estate in which there are no
funds immediately available to pay fees, the fees need not be paid in advance, but shall be paid
as soon as funds become available.
(3) No officer shall collect fees in advance in any collection action initiated pursuant to
section 18-1.3-506, C.R.S.
